At present, most of the research results of AI on financial models are trained based on public knowledge. However, in actual financial practice, the interpretability of this public knowledge for the current market is often seriously insufficient. An ideal financial big model should be able to understand news or data events and be able to instantly interpret the events from both subjective and quantitative perspectives.

Orca-Math is a mathematical reasoning model released by Microsoft Research that demonstrates the value of smaller specialized models in specific areas, which can match or even exceed the performance of larger models. Microsoft recently open-sourced the Orca-Math-200K math word quiz used to train Orca-Math.

The diagnosis of ophthalmic diseases is highly dependent on image recognition, and ophthalmology is very suitable for the application of technologies such as deep learning. In order to further explore the potential value of deep learning in the diagnosis of fundus diseases, five ophthalmology centers across the country, led by Chen Youxin, director of the Department of Ophthalmology at Peking Union Medical College Hospital, worked with Beijing Zhiyuan Huitu Technology Co., Ltd. and Professor Li Xirong of the School of Information at Renmin University of China to jointly develop a deep learning system.
The system helped primary ophthalmologists improve their diagnostic consistency by about 12% and provided a new method for the automatic detection of 13 major fundus diseases. This article is a further interpretation and sharing of the study →
